Direct naar content

Database tuning

OptimaData is happy to assist with database optimization to help you get the most out of your database. A combination of outdated versions, increasing usage, growth of the application landscape, and upgrades can cause the database to slow down. We provide hands-on assistance to improve database performance with a proven, structured approach. On-premise databases, databases on cloud servers, or cloud databases (PaaS or DBaaS). Maximum database optimization. See the chart next to this text for an illustration of the results from a typical one-day tuning session.

Database optimalisatie door OptimaData

Database QuickScan

During a database QuickScan, the entire database environment (including related applications) is examined. On-premise, in the cloud or cloud databases (PaaS or DBaaS). All aspects of your database environment are addressed in this complete consulting process. In addition to your specific issues.

This includes the following topics:

  • Logical data model
  • Technical data model
  • Hardware platform
  • Generic settings
  • Performance & tuning
  • High availability
  • Disaster recovery
Database QuickScan door OptimaData

How does database QuickScan work?

A QuickScan begins with a comprehensive questionnaire. This serves to prepare our consultant for an interview session with the client. The consultant will then be happy to meet with at least 2 employees on site to discuss all the ins and outs of the database and related applications.

Based on this information and extracted data from the database environment in question, a thorough analysis will take place. Based on this analysis an extensive Consultancy QuickScan Report will be delivered.

This will not only report findings but also a set of short, medium and long-term recommendations on each topic. Finally, during a presentation of the report, we will explain the findings and recommendations, discuss them with the client and suggest the most appropriate follow-up.

Results of a Database QuickScan

With the database QuickScan report, the client gains a comprehensive overview and insight to optimize the database environment, improve performance, and address specific action points. It is then up to the client to choose whether to implement the recommendations at their own pace or to have OptimaData execute the next steps.

It is also possible to organize database management with OptimaData after a QuickScan, for instance through Managed Consultancy.

Costs of a Database QuickScan

We do a QuickScan for a fixed price. Feel free to ask about the possibilities.

Database performance tuning

Database performance tuning is a profession in its own right. It depends on several factors how this should be handled.

Through a combination of proper tooling and our practical experience, performance gains can often be achieved within 1 day. However, one-day tuning is an inexpensive alternative to the QuickScan and is certainly not a replacement.

Database QuickScan as a starting point

Essentially, we recommend having a Database QuickScan done first, so that we get to know the ins and outs of the database and related applications and/or websites. That way OptimaData can perform database performance tuning with optimal and lasting results.

Database tuning en optimisation

The type of database (Data Warehouse or Online Transaction Processing (OLTP)), the size of the database, the quality of the data model (both logical and technical), the version of the database, the Operating System and the hardware are all things that play a role in performance tuning.

OptimaData heeft snel en effectief gereageerd. Ik durf te stellen dat door hun inbreng de performance van de database omgeving sterk is verbeterd.

Marcel Oudmaijer

Kadant

Security and performance

Professioneel en deskundig

Performance tuning requires a trade-off between security and performance. High performance can lead to data security being compromised.

That is, in the event of a system crash, not all data is on disk and no recovery is possible. There are alternatives to this such as synchronous or asynchronous replication.

Best practices

SQL Server best practices, MySQL, MariaDB, PostgreSQL, MongoDB configuration parameter tuning are factors that can make a difference for system availability and optimal performance.

With our years of experience, we have developed an extensive set of best practices for nearly every database in any circumstance or situation. Whether on-premise, in the cloud, cloud databases (PaaS or DBaaS), or a hybrid platform.

Ervaring

OptimaData’s database consultants have performed performance tuning for databases of hundreds of GigaBytes. In addition, OptimaData has installed connection pooling for several clients with large OLTP systems, for example. We also have extensive experience with in-depth SQL query tuning and have achieved wonderful results.

“We bieden onze applicaties hosted aan en de data(bases) vormen het hart van ons cloud platform. We werken daar elke dag aan met een team van in-huis specialisten. OptimaData biedt ons een waardevolle toevoeging door daar van buitenaf kritisch naar te kijken en deskundige aanbevelingen te doen voor volgende stappen. Vervolgens helpen ze ons concreet met de implementatie daarvan. We voelen ons dan ook een gewaardeerde klant van OptimaData.”

Karin Valk

Algemeen Directeur - Valk Solutions

Learn more about database performance tuning?

OptimaData can achieve performance improvement in a short time, often within 1 day a significant optimization in the database environment can be observed!

Benchmarking

Database consultancyWant to know more! By performing one or more benchmarks on your database platform, insight can be gained into the optimal configuration. Not only in terms of infrastructure, but also in terms of operating system settings, database configuration and disk layout.

Live demo of your ideal database platform

Using an exquisite set of tooling and consulting experience, OptimaData can present reliable results after performing a benchmark or simulation that will provide you with the insights to take the right steps.

Hybride Automation Cloud Database Management Platform

OptimaData has its own test and development environment. This is hybrid set up with cloud and onpremise servers where we can build, simulate and configure any possible infrastructure and combinations of database platforms, tooling, cloud providers, clustering, High Availability. Even automated HealthChecks are possible.

Looking into the future

A benchmark or simulation gives you a look at the environment where your database is operating optimally. Or where you see the possible chosen database platform operating where all disruptive factors are excluded. With no impact on your existing environment and production environment. We can show “what would happen if…”

Want to know more about a benchmark or even a POC?

Our core values

Thomas Spoelstra

Teamlead en Senior Database Reliability Engineer
Thomas Spoelstra - Teamlead en Senior Database Reliability Engineer
01 04

Interesting blogs

All blogs